For shops adding first-time automation
The CRX collaborative robot series spans payloads from 3 kg to 30 kg and is aimed at teams with limited robotics experience. Programming runs through a tablet teach pendant with drag-and-drop motion blocks, hand guidance, and contact-stop safety, which shortens the path from first install to production runs on tending, picking, dispensing, and light welding tasks.
FANUC also offers application-specific CRX variants that matter on a trade-show floor where buyers compare regulated environments: food-grade models with NSF-H1 grease and washdown-friendly finishes, a paint cobot rated for coating and dispensing work, and welding configurations bundled with partner systems. The line is positioned around eight years of maintenance-free operation, a practical selling point for shops calculating total cost of ownership against labor availability rather than sticker price alone.
For high-throughput machining and tending
FANUC CNC controls and ROBODRILL compact machining centers address the core IMTS audience: job shops, contract manufacturers, and OEM production teams running turning, milling, and multi-axis work. FANUC's control portfolio is built around long mean time between failure and integration with its own servo and spindle ecosystems, which reduces the integration friction when a shop retrofits an existing machine or specs a new cell.
ROBODRILL units fill another common gap on the floor: compact footprints for drilling, tapping, and light milling where floor space and unattended runtime matter more than full five-axis complexity. Pairing a ROBODRILL with a CRX tending solution is a recurring conversation at FANUC booths because it shows how a smaller shop can automate overnight runs without building a greenfield line.
For AI-driven, adaptive production lines
Physical AI and vision-guided robotics are the thread tying FANUC's main booth to the wider IMTS floor. In AMT's Emerging Technology Center, FANUC joins Oak Ridge National Laboratory and Mazak on a continuously running cell that produces drone airframes using hybrid machining and robotic assembly, then integrates, tests, and disassembles units to show how modern factories recover from disruption under real constraints.
At booth 338900, expect live demonstrations in the same problem space: robots that track moving workpieces for fastening and inspection, generative-AI-assisted programming that turns natural-language instructions into motion, and digital-twin workflows that let engineers validate cells before metal is cut. These are not slide-deck concepts. They are the kinds of demos FANUC has been running at recent Chicago shows, including real-time bolt tightening on a moving engine block and vision-guided box handling with dynamic proximity monitoring when operators approach the work zone.

Who you're talking to
FANUC developed Japan's first private-sector NC system in 1956 and has operated as an independent public company since 1972, headquartered in Yamanashi Prefecture at the base of Mt. Fuji. The company's manufacturing campuses run highly automated production for CNC, servo, robot, and ROBOMACHINE assembly, which gives its booth conversations a credible "builder, not assembler" tone.
FANUC America, based in Rochester Hills, Michigan, is the face most North American IMTS attendees know. It distributes controls, robots, and ROBOMACHINE products across the Americas and backs them with a Service First policy: lifetime maintenance support for equipment in the field. For buyers comparing automation vendors on downtime risk, that service density, authorized integrator coverage, and spare-parts logistics are often as important as the demo cycle time shown on the carpet.
FANUC's Americas go-to-market leans on one of the industry's largest authorized integrator networks. That matters at IMTS because many visitors are not buying a robot off the show floor; they are scoping a project timeline, integrator shortlist, and training plan. Academy and field-service resources in Rochester Hills and regional offices support that longer post-show cycle.

Frequently asked questions
What does FANUC manufacture?
FANUC manufactures factory automation (FA) systems including CNC controls and servo drives, industrial and collaborative robots, and ROBOMACHINE products such as ROBODRILL machining centers, ROBOSHOT injection molding machines, and ROBOCUT wire EDM systems. The company also offers IoT platforms like FIELD system for connecting shop-floor equipment to digital production systems.
